Rough-in, inspection, and finish work coordinated with your build

The plumbing installation in Boulder begins with reviewing the building plans, then running supply and drain lines through the framing before drywall goes up. The rough-in phase includes placing pipes for sinks, toilets, showers, dishwashers, water heaters, and any other fixtures or appliances that require water or drainage.


Once the rough-in passes inspection and walls are finished, the plumber returns to install fixtures, connect appliances, test water pressure, check for leaks, and verify that drains flow correctly. You will turn on faucets that deliver steady pressure, flush toilets that clear completely, and run showers that drain without backup or pooling.


The installation meets local building codes and coordinates with the general contractor's schedule to avoid delays. The service does not include site excavation or foundation work, but it does cover everything from the main sewer connection to the final fixture installation, including any specialized plumbing for commercial kitchens, medical facilities, or multi-unit buildings.

What happens if the building design changes after rough-in starts?

If fixture locations or layout changes occur, the plumber adjusts pipe placement and stub-out positions as needed. Changes may affect the timeline and cost depending on how much work has already been completed.

How long does plumbing installation take on a typical project?

Timeline depends on building size, fixture count, and how the work fits into the construction schedule. A single-family home in Boulder might take a few days for rough-in and another day for finish work, while larger commercial projects take longer.
